BUDGET airline Cebu Pacific (CEB) is the domestic aviation market leader based on Civil Aeronautics Board (CAB) passenger data from January to June 2007.

CEB carried a total of 2,256,289 passengers for the period in review compared to Philippine Airlines’ (PAL) 1,981,267.

The Gokongwei-owned carrier also registered an 84% load factor compared to 80% and 72% of its nearest competitors.

CEB’s total domestic passenger carriage in the first semester of 2007 soared 72% from 1,310,376 commuters for the first half of last year. Load factor percentage was also up from 74% for 2006.

The CAB data showed that the domestic air travel market rose 24% in the first half of 2007.
